Easter Fruit Fluff Salad

Easter Fruit Fluff Salad: A Refreshingly Sweet Delight for Your Table


5 Stars 4 Stars 3 Stars 2 Stars 1 Star

No reviews

  • Author: Souzan
  • Total Time: 1 hour 15 minutes
  • Yield: 6 servings
  • Diet: Vegetarian

Description

Easter Fruit Fluff Salad is a delightful mix of fruits and cream that brings a refreshing sweetness to your festive table.


Ingredients

Scale
  • 2 cups miniature marshmallows
  • 1 cup pineapple chunks, drained
  • 1 cup strawberries, hulled and sliced
  • 1 cup blueberries
  • 1 cup whipped topping
  • 1/2 cup shredded coconut
  • 1 tablespoon lemon juice


Instructions

  1. In a large mixing bowl, combine the mini marshmallows, pineapple chunks, sliced strawberries, and blueberries.
  2. Add the whipped topping and gently fold in the ingredients until well combined.
  3. Stir in the shredded coconut and lemon juice.
  4. Cover and refrigerate for at least 1 hour before serving to let the flavors meld.
  5. Serve chilled and enjoy the refreshing sweetness!

Notes

  • This salad can be made a day in advance to save time on your holiday prep.
  • Add more fruits as per your preference, such as bananas or grapes.
